How many times have you seen a heart tugging video on television that is urging you to support feeding hungry kids in Africa or help dig wells in the Middle East or some other worthy cause? How many times have you donated to those causes over the years? Do you really know where that money goes?

“Well, surely, brother Bob, it goes to those causes, other than just a little bit for administrative purposes.” Are you sure? Have you checked?

I know, when I was working in an administrative capacity for the American Red Cross, they maintained that 90% of their donations reached the intended target for the donation. Back then, and I can only attest for back in the mid-1990’s, I can’t say for sure what it is today, they kept back 10% for administrative expenses.

But, if you really dig, most non-profits do not do that.

To help in that area, and to allow you to donate to various projects that are on your heart, I’ve invited Christopher Jones to join us today to tell us about his “Mall of Hope.”

The “Mall of Hope” operates on that 10% and 90% principle. Something that is almost unheard of in non-profits today. To discuss this and some other things he has set up to be a blessing to others, help me welcome to the program, Christopher Jones!

I am a 12 year Army veteran as both enlisted and as a commissioned Cavalry Officer.
I am now a retired law enforcement supervisor...

I had my own business for seven years before I entered law enforcement.

As a cop, I was injured on the job on May 12, 2007 and after several surgeries over a couple of years, forced to retire in 2011.

As I was looking down the road to “what am I going to do next?” I started what is now known as a podcast (I had no clue at the time).

Within six months of starting (what I called) “My online radio program” I was offered an opportunity to be on nationwide AM radio. I learned A LOT in one year of doing that!

I then started the online Christian radio platform "Evangelism Radio" in the fall of 2010. It has had listeners in 160+ nations and all 50 states. We host 50+ Christian broadcasters on a weekly basis. We have been operating 24/7 for almost 14 years now. We have been rated #1 in the world by Shoutcast. com on several occasions in our genre. We recently transferred ownership of Evangelism Radio to another ministry so I could concentrate full time on podcasting, preaching and writing.

In 2018, I started the Kingdom Cross Roads Podcast to conduct interviews with Christian influencers from all walks of life and to play their interviews on the radio station. (The KCR Podcast has its own time slot on Evangelism Radio)!
We now have over 1600 episodes and almost 1100 interviews (in just over 6 years).
